Ukrainian and Russian negotiators began a second round of U.S.-brokered talks in Abu Dhabi on Wednesday (February 4), seeking to advance efforts to end Europe's biggest conflict since World War Two as fighting raged on.

The two-day trilateral meetings come after Ukraine's President Volodymyr Zelenskiy said Russia had exploited a U.S.-backed energy truce last week to stockpile munitions, attacking Ukraine with a record number of ballistic missiles on Tuesday (February 4).

"Another round of negotiations has begun in Abu Dhabi," said Rustem Umerov, Ukraine's top negotiator, on the Telegram app. "The negotiation process started in a trilateral format — Ukraine, the United States, and Russia."

Photographs released by the United Arab Emirates' foreign ministry showed the three delegations sitting around a U-shaped table, with U.S. officials seated at the center, including special envoy Steve Witkoff and U.S. President Donald Trump's son-in-law Jared Kushner.

Umerov said that teams would later meet in separate groups to discuss specific topics and would then follow up with a joint meeting to coordinate their positions.
